Description:
This volume combines an introduction to central collineations with an introduction to projective geometry, set in its historical context and aiming to provide the reader with a general history through the middle of the nineteenth century. Topics covered include but are not limited to:

  • The Projective Plane and Central Collineations
  • The Geometry of Euclid’s Elements
  • Conic Sections in Early Modern Europe
  • Applications of Conics in History

With rare exception, the only prior knowledge required is a background in high school geometry. As a proof-based treatment, this monograph will be of interest to those who enjoy logical thinking, and could also be used in a geometry course that emphasizes projective geometry.
